About AARP New Mexico

We work to ensure that our neighborhoods, cities and communities are livable so people can stay in place, at home, as they age. We do this by making sure there is adequate public transportation services; affordable housing; social participation; and nearby health services.

AARP New Mexico also visits communities across the state conducting events and forums on topics important to you and your family such as strengthening Medicare and Social Security for the future and helping people protect their finances by avoiding scams and fraud. And we provide resources to help with financial planning whether an individual is still working or moving toward retirement.

We make available access to products, services and discounts and fight for consumer protections so people can save real money for themselves and their families— and turn their dream of a better future into reality.
